Follow-up Comment #1, bug #25624 (project wesnoth): help & [variation]s: effect of the hide_help key
Imagine you have one unit with one variation. Like Konrad in HttT. And imagine you don't use inherit=yes (unlike the zombies), not sure if that would make a difference. Currently Konrad and Li'sar use hide_help=yes for the variation, and not for the main unit. This has three effects -> 1) the variation is not shown in the help browser -> 2) the variation is not shown in the main units wiki page. There would usually be a line "variations:" -> 3) when the variation is in effect, e.g. Konrad has the sceptre, it shows the page of the main unit instead of the variation. This is different than in the usual cases where hide_help=yes it used. As a rule of thumb, hide_help=yes does hide the unit in the help system, but there exists still a help page which is only accessible if the unit is on the field. tl;dr, Konrads Sceptre attack isn't displayed in the help when he has it. Why did the designer decide for that? We'll, let's have a look at the other options: Using hide_help=yes for both: -> they are both not accessible in the help browser. That's mostly fine for heroes. -> the main unit's help page is still accessible on the map, the variation has still the same problem as before Using hide_help=no for both: -> the variation's help entry can now be accessed over the map, but also over the help and -> due to the "variations:" line in the main units help entry this would spoil the player For completeness sake (or rather, to show another issue) Using hide_help=yes only for the main unit: -> Isn't useful here -> the variation has usually a link to the base unit. That link is now displayed in red and broken.
